The Society for Integrative Oncology announced today that it is collaborating with the American Society of Clinical Oncology, Inc. (ASCO®), the world’s leading professional organization of its kind representing oncology professionals who care for people living with cancer, to develop a series of evidence-based clinical practice guidelines for integrative therapies in oncology care.
